Transaction cdc58d76a939f87cd18cf92de84c08616c7f0665083314f1ecc68bb7bb467059
1 Input
1 Output
-
cdc58d76a939f87cd18cf92de84c08616c7f0665083314f1ecc68bb7bb467059:0
- value
- 756027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c54533c8a714ebefa669ff2c353892b855e10830 OP_EQUAL
- address
- 3Kg5wbMQC84gDSguyipkBvac9Q4aEfmypf